What is Delta-Homes.com?


Delta-Homes.com is a browser hijacker that has compromised millions of computers running different operating systems. If you are the one who infects with this browser hijacker, you may encounter the following problems.

Your default browser homepage is replaced by delta-homes.com;
Your default search engine is replaced by Delta Search;
Your search results are messed up by unrelated contents and suspicious third party ads;
There may be additional extensions or toolbars added to your web browsers;
You will find suspected pop-up, pop-under, in-text, or banner advertisements on every site that you visit.


Technically, Delta-Homes.com is not a virus. It often comes bundled with other software such as Softonic, Babylon Toolbar, uTorrent, Any.Do, BeeLine Reader, Foxit Reader and similar freeware. It has the capability of affecting all the web browsers installed on your computers. You will not enjoy your pleasant internet browsing any more. Except for that, you may encounter identity theft or expose your sensitive information to risk due to this pesky browser hijacker. Method 1: Remove Delta-Homes.com Step by Step


Step 1: End Delta-Homes.com process from Windows Task Manager

Methods to open Windows Task Manager: Press CTRL+ALT+DEL or CTRL+SHIFT+ESC or press the Start button, type "Run" to select the option, then type "taskmgr" and press OK.

* end the one related to the PUP
* you should end the one to the infected browser (e.g. chrome.exe) if your browser is frozen/locked.



Step 2: Uninstall Delta-Homes.com from Control Panel

* Go to Start Menu >> Control Panle
* Press Win & R on your keyboard to open Run. Type in "control" to open Control Panel
Select Uninstall a program (from category)/Program and Features (from small icon). Search PUP related to Delta-Homes.com from the list and remove it.

 

Step 2: Remove Delta-Homes.com from web browser.

Internet Explorer
Go to Tools >> Manage add-ons



Move to Toolbars and Extensions >> Remove items related to Delta-Homes.com.
Move to Search Providers >> select  items related to Delta-Homes.com  and remove it.


Go back to Tools >> Internet Options

* in General tab, rewrite your home page URL or Use Default from Homepage. And then click Delete... from Browsing history


* in Advanced tab >> Reset... >> check Delete personal settings >> Reset



Google Chrome
Go to Customize and control Google Chrome (top right menu) >> Tools/Settings >> Extension >> Remove suspicious extensions


Reset your settings on On startup >> Set pages, Appearance >> Change, and Search >> Manage search engines...
 

Show advanced settings >> Reset  settings

Mozilla Firefox

Open menu >> Add-on >> remove unwanted extensions and plugins
 

Back to Menu >> Option >> General. You can rewrite your home page URL or Restore to Default


Press alt & h, select Troubleshooting and Information >> Reset or Refresh Firefox


Step 3: Delete from local disk.

Type "Delta-Homes.com" in start menu, right click the item to open files location. And then delete the files. Usually in the below files:

%AppData%
%CommonAppData%
%temp%
C:\Windows\Temp\
C:\Program Files\

Step 4: Delete infected or additional registry entries.

Press Win & R  to open Run, type in "regedit" and hit enter. Click Edit >> Find... to search unwanted keys
